About the Role
Envigaurd is looking for a detail-oriented HVAC Draftsman to prepare accurate design and installation drawings for our HVAC and turnkey MEP projects. The role sits at the core of our design team, translating engineering calculations and site requirements into clear, code-compliant drawings that guide procurement, fabrication, and site execution.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are HVAC layout drawings, ducting layouts, piping layouts, schematic diagrams (SLD/DLD), and coordination drawings using AutoCAD (2D/3D).
- Draft installation drawings for supply air, return air, fresh air, and exhaust air ductwork, including duct insulation details.
- Detail ductwork components: plenum boxes, grilles, diffusers, fire dampers, VCDs, louvers, and sound attenuators.
- Prepare shop drawings and as-built drawings for HVAC systems on active projects.
- Support duct and pipe sizing calculations under the guidance of the design engineer, using standard tools (McQuay Duct Sizer, McQuay Pipe Sizer, or equivalent).
- Coordinate drawings with architectural, structural, and other MEP disciplines (electrical, plumbing, fire-fighting) to avoid clashes.
- Assist in preparing BOQ/BOM documentation and material take-offs based on finalized drawings.
- Incorporate ASHRAE / SMACNA / ISHRAE / local building code standards into all drafting work.
- Revise drawings promptly based on site feedback, RFIs, and design changes.
- Maintain organized drawing records and version control for all project documentation.
